In a compelling exploration of metaphysical concepts, Thomas Collyns Simon delves into the essence of the external world, presenting a thorough examination of universal immaterialism. This work invites readers to question the nature of reality and perception, proposing that our understanding of the world is shaped by immaterial rather than material elements.

The careful construction of the text, complemented by its elegant leather binding and golden leaf accents, adds a tangible richness to the reading experience. Through engaging prose, Simon challenges conventional beliefs, encouraging a thoughtful dialogue on the philosophical implications of immaterialism and its impact on how we perceive our surroundings.
